Output 8942c9080c11d20ab8b2f31d0574f01a0317d65083b3f21efe6bb4aa7571e22a:76

value
315291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b08a8b7340fa0aa5828c8cb40287e441a5b7874 OP_EQUAL
address
3BSxbiAq3XYFVFJRLAnPWrj3Dm3cTMMowy
transaction
8942c9080c11d20ab8b2f31d0574f01a0317d65083b3f21efe6bb4aa7571e22a
confirmations
202162
spent
true